Python Urlretrieve Limit Rate And Resume Partial Download

I'm using the code from this thread to limit my download rate. How do I incorporate partial downloads resuming with the rate limiting code? The examples I've found use urlopen i

Solution 1:

May be able to use PyCurl instead:

def curl_progress(total, existing, upload_t, upload_d):
    try:
        frac = float(existing)/float(total)
    except:
        frac = 0
    print "Downloaded %d/%d (%0.2f%%)" % (existing, total, frac)

def curl_limit_rate(url, filename, rate_limit):
    """Rate limit in bytes"""
    import pycurl
    c = pycurl.Curl()
    c.setopt(c.URL, url)
    c.setopt(c.MAX_RECV_SPEED_LARGE, rate_limit)
    if os.path.exists(filename):
        file_id = open(filename, "ab")
        c.setopt(c.RESUME_FROM, os.path.getsize(filename))
    else:
        file_id = open(filename, "wb")

    c.setopt(c.WRITEDATA, file_id)
    c.setopt(c.NOPROGRESS, 0)
    c.setopt(c.PROGRESSFUNCTION, curl_progress)
    c.perform()
